Transaction 72acd391d1d31539f35e6228f9598715a2f8e3244cd4dffc0b287cc2676e66df
2 Input
1 Outputs
- 72acd391d1d31539f35e6228f9598715a2f8e3244cd4dffc0b287cc2676e66df:0
value 9043980
address 1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G